The Sunflower Community Radio Association operates as a legitimate Club/Society with a committee on a not-for-profit basis for community social gain through the distribution of information. We are not a business.  The Sunflower provides free careline air-time to not-for-profit organisations. The Sunflower is  funded via donations, sponsorship and event attendance.
